  • Patent number: 11654911
    Abstract: The powertrain device for a vehicle includes an engine and an automatic transmission, the automatic transmission includes a plurality of friction fastening elements for selectively switching motive power transmitting paths, a predetermined friction fastening element among the plurality of friction fastening elements is a travel-start friction fastening element performing slip control in a travel start, and the powertrain device includes, between the engine and the automatic transmission, a motive power connection-disconnection clutch which is released at least in an engine start and is fastened earlier than the travel-start friction fastening element in a travel start of the vehicle.
    Type: Grant
    Filed: March 13, 2020
    Date of Patent: May 23, 2023
    Assignee: Mazda Motor Corporation
    Inventors: Narihito Hongawara, Takuya Sugisawa, Keitaro Kageyama, Satoshi Fujikawa, Hiroki Tanabe, Shingo Kodama

  • Patent number: 11203259
    Abstract: A power train device of a vehicle includes an engine and an automatic transmission. The automatic transmission is configured such that in a neutral state, multiple ones of multiple rotary elements forming a power transmission path other than a rotary element coupled to an input member and a rotary element coupled to an output member are in a non-restraining state. The multiple ones of the multiple rotary elements include a rotary element of a predetermined brake among multiple friction fastening elements, and the predetermined brake is fastened before a fuel supply upon an engine start.
    Type: Grant
    Filed: March 2, 2020
    Date of Patent: December 21, 2021
    Assignee: Mazda Motor Corporation
    Inventors: Narihito Hongawara, Takuya Sugisawa, Keitaro Kageyama, Satoshi Fujikawa, Hiroki Tanabe, Shingo Kodama
  • Patent number: 11143293
    Abstract: A power train device for a vehicle is provided with a selector valve that is switched between a first state in which oil discharged from an electric oil pump is able to be supplied as a hydraulic fluid to an engagement hydraulic chamber of a vehicle-starting frictional engagement element, and a second state in which the oil is able to be supplied as a lubricating oil to the vehicle-starting frictional engagement element through a first lubricating oil supply circuit, depending on a magnitude of a discharge pressure of a mechanical oil pump.
    Type: Grant
    Filed: October 23, 2018
    Date of Patent: October 12, 2021
    Assignee: Mazda Motor Corporation
    Inventors: Keitaro Kageyama, Shotaro Nagai, Takashi Ishiyama, Takuya Sugisawa
